The sandbox enforces memory caps, blocks filesystem calls, and strips network primitives from the expression tree. In rare incidents — a sandbox deadlock blocking all tenant evaluations — break-glass access lets an approved maintainer bypass isolation for one session. This requires two approvals from the Tallygrove security rotation and a logged justification. Once approvals are recorded, unlock the override console using the recovery passphrase shown below.

unlock words, tawif-tahop: oliys-ulawyn-tamdor-lamys-casox-jormir-fraius-kasath-ulador-ulamir-holir-sorys-holeth

## Deployment

The Lumacache image service has a known slow leak in its thumbnail cache layer: evicted entries keep a reference alive through the decoder pool, so resident memory creeps up roughly 40 MB per hour under steady load. Until the refactor in the Harkness branch lands, we mitigate by capping pool size and scheduling a rolling restart every 12 hours. Deploy with the supervisor, never bare, or the restart hook won't fire. The deployment relies on the configuration values listed below.

settings of bagug-tahof:
holath:
  pin: 7837
  metrics_host: metrics.holath.tolvaqsys.internal
  tenant: quenath
  seal: seal_6001b3af

# Build Provenance — Chalkline Timetable Solver

This page explains how support can verify which solver build produced a given timetable. Every run embeds its build fingerprint in the output header, so when a school reports an odd schedule, ask them for that header first. Match it against the release ledger before escalating — most "solver bugs" turn out to be stale builds. Builds older than three releases are unsupported and should be upgraded, not debugged. The current verified build fingerprint is below.

build token for bajog-yaduf: htk9_39788324c